India, Aug. 24 -- Arsenal made history once again by handing academy star Max Dowman his first Premier League appearance at the age of just 15. The youngster came off the bench in the 64th minute during Arsenal's emphatic 5-0 victory over Leeds United at the Emirates Stadium, the Independent reported.
Dowman replaced Noni Madueke and immediately showed confidence and maturity on the field. At 15 years and 229 days, he became the second youngest player to play for Arsenal in a Premier League match, behind only Ethan Nwaneri, who debuted in 2022 at 15 years and 181 days, according to the news outlet.
